Behavioral Analytics in Dee IASIP
Behavioral analytics within Dee IASIP focuses on deviations from expected patterns rather than isolated events. By modeling baseline activities, the approach highlights subtle shifts that may precede incidents.
Algorithms weight indicators such as access frequency, resource types, and peer group comparisons. When combined with contextual metadata, these signals support more precise triage and fewer false leads for security staff.
Modeling Methodology
Statistical and machine learning techniques are applied to historical logs to identify typical workflows and outlier scenarios. Models are recalibrated regularly to reflect organizational changes, reducing drift and maintaining relevance over time.
Risk Assessment Methodology
Dee IASIP structures risk assessment around asset value, threat likelihood, and control effectiveness. This systematic view aligns technical findings with business impact and regulatory expectations.
Assessment cycles define thresholds, scoring rubrics, and review cadence. Stakeholders across operations, legal, and technology collaborate to validate assumptions and agree on remediation priorities.
Implementation Roadmap and Controls
Implementing Dee IASIP follows a phased roadmap that balances quick wins with long-term capability building. Early phases establish visibility, while later stages integrate automation, refine playbooks, and scale coverage.
Controls are mapped to frameworks such as NIST and ISO to clarify responsibilities and evidence requirements. Continuous measurement links security performance to resiliency outcomes, enabling data-driven adjustments.

How does Dee IASIP integrate with existing security toolsets?
Dee IASIP connects to SIEM, EDR, identity, and HR systems via APIs and normalized data models. It enriches existing telemetry with behavioral context, rather than replacing established platforms.
What are the most common indicators that Dee IASIP surfaces early?
Common early indicators include abnormal login geographies, spikes in privileged queries, repeated policy exceptions, and unusual vendor access sequences.
Can Dee IASIP be applied in regulated industries with strict compliance requirements?
Yes, Dee IASIP maps controls to regulatory expectations, maintains audit trails, and aligns with sector-specific guidance, making it suitable for highly regulated environments.
How frequently should assessment cycles and behavioral models be updated?
Organizations typically refresh behavioral baselines quarterly and full risk assessments semi-annually, adjusting more rapidly after major incidents or structural changes.
